Tiivistelmä
Now, in 2014 it is hard to believe that once there was a life without touchscreen devices, “tweets” and “likes”, Wi-Fi or bandwidth problems. The explosion of Internet changed the entire world, speeded up the information flow and brought a new language and lifestyle into the weekdays.
The aim of this research is to introduce these changes, the current trends and the most remarkable technological achievements and their effects, first in general then focusing on the hotel industry. Are the technological-base services more beneficial than the traditional human touch? Could technology substitute a honest smile? The answers could be found also in this paper.
This study also introduces the findings whether a business would survive without online social networking in these days. It examines the power of social media, based on academic journals and real life experiences.
Nobody knows exactly, what the future brings but there are certain ways to find the right direction; or is the future unpredictable? What will be the future careers? Will robots be the substitutes of human beings?
General Managers of Restel Hotel Group in Helsinki area were asked what they thought about this digital life and what they expected from the future and the future hotel industry.
This study is built on referred academic journals, recently published articles, reports, books, videos and own experiences.
